
The team at Flatirons Tuning in Boulder, CO talks about motorsports, Subaru, rally racing, time attack, wheel to wheel racing, the Pikes Peak Hill Climb, current events in the car world, and sometimes we get technical about car parts. We sit down with a group of drivers and experts each week to tackle new topics and bring you stories, news, information, and updates.

A motorsports-focused show from a Boulder, CO-based tuning shop discusses Subaru tuning, rally, time attack, and track-oriented engineering. Episodes cover technical deep-dives on drivetrains, differential control, and hybrid concepts, blended with industry news, drivetrain development, and race-new product discussions. The hosts often bring in guests from tuning shops, media, and aftermarket brands to provide insider perspectives on branding, parts ecosystems, and competitive performance, making it a strong resource for grassroots and semi-professional enthusiasts who want practical insights and real-world build stories.
